Combating Cross-Domain Attacks: Strengthening Identity Security

In the ever-evolving landscape of cybersecurity, cross-domain attacks have surfaced as one of the most sophisticated threats, challenging traditional security measures. These attacks exploit vulnerabilities across various domains, such as endpoints, identity systems, and cloud environments, allowing adversaries to infiltrate organizations, move laterally, and avoid detection. As eCrime groups and state-sponsored adversaries increasingly rely on cross-domain tactics, it has become imperative for organizations to adopt a proactive approach to safeguarding their identity infrastructure. In this article, we will delve into three essential steps to strengthen identity security and combat the growing menace of cross-domain attacks.

Identity as the Foundation: Establishing the Base

Modern security strategies must evolve beyond isolated solutions to truly combat the sophisticated nature of cross-domain attacks. By integrating threat detection and response across identity, endpoint, and cloud within a single platform, organizations can build a solid foundation for comprehensive defense. Placing identity at the core of security operations eradicates the inefficiencies of fragmented tools, creating a cohesive and streamlined architecture that enhances overall security posture.

This unified approach not only speeds up response times but also simplifies security operations by consolidating various functionalities into a single platform. Consequently, organizations can achieve significant cost savings by improving collaboration across teams and replacing disconnected point solutions with an integrated system that seamlessly secures identity against cross-domain threats. Furthermore, this method ensures that security measures are more robust and responsive to emerging threats, thereby increasing the likelihood of foiling adversaries’ attempts to exploit weaknesses across interconnected environments.

Identity Awareness: Viewing the Complete Picture

To fortify identity security, it is crucial to achieve comprehensive visibility across hybrid environments, including on-premises, cloud, and SaaS applications. By integrating security tools and eliminating blind spots, organizations can ensure that adversaries have fewer opportunities to exploit gaps in their defenses. Seamless integration with on-premises directories, cloud identity providers like Entra ID and Okta, and various SaaS applications provides a holistic view of all access points, transforming identity systems into fortified perimeters.

This full-spectrum visibility is instrumental in detecting and mitigating potential threats that could otherwise go unnoticed. By unifying disparate identity-related tools, organizations can create an interconnected security framework that continuously monitors and protects against unauthorized access. When security teams have a complete view of their identity landscape, they can more effectively prioritize and respond to suspicious activities, minimizing the risk of security breaches. Consequently, achieving comprehensive visibility is a critical step toward strengthening an organization’s overall security posture and defending against cross-domain attacks.

Immediate Identity Defense: Enhancing Detection and Response

To effectively combat cross-domain attacks, organizations must implement immediate identity defense measures that enhance detection capabilities and response times. This involves deploying advanced threat detection technologies that can identify and assess potential risks in real-time. Implementing robust access controls is another critical step in safeguarding identity infrastructures. By ensuring that only authorized personnel have access to sensitive systems and data, organizations can minimize the risk of unauthorized access and lateral movement by attackers.

Continuous monitoring for suspicious activities is essential to detect and respond to any anomalies that may indicate a breach. Security teams should establish automated alerts and response protocols to swiftly address potential threats, reducing the window of opportunity for attackers to cause damage. By adopting these proactive measures, organizations can create a resilient security framework that effectively counters the sophisticated tactics employed in cross-domain attacks, ultimately ensuring the integrity and security of their identity systems.
